The Rise of Online Marketing in the Nepalese Landscape

 

Traditionally, Nepalese businesses relied heavily on offline marketing tools like print media and word-of-mouth.

According to The Management Information System (MIS) report 2021 published recently by Nepal Telecommunications Authority (NTA), there are more than 38.21 million mobile phone users in Nepal as of mid-January 2021.

Also, as per various resources. As of January 2022, there were 11.51 million internet users in Nepal, with an internet penetration rate of 38.4% of the total population. The number of internet users in Nepal increased by 315 thousand (+3.2%) between 2019 and 2020.

This shows a rapid increase of digital literacy in people. People are increasingly turning to online platforms for information, shopping, and connecting with brands. This shift necessitates a focus on online marketing strategies to effectively reach your target audience.

 

Benefits of Digital Marketing for Small Businesses in Nepal

 

For small businesses in Nepal, digital marketing offers a cost-effective and powerful gateway to achieving their growth aspirations. Here are some key advantages:

  1. Wider Reach: Unlike conventional marketing methods, digital marketing services empower you to target a far broader audience, even transcending geographical limitations. You can connect with potential customers across Nepal and even internationally, significantly expanding your market reach.
  2. Cost-Effectiveness: Compared to traditional advertising methods, digital marketing offers a more cost-efficient way to reach your target audience. You can tailor your budget and target specific demographics, ensuring a higher return on investment (ROI) for your marketing efforts.
  3. Measurable Results: One of the biggest advantages  is the ability to measure its effectiveness in real-time. Through analytics tools and insightful data, you can track campaign performance, identify what resonates with your audience, and adapt your strategies accordingly.
  4. Increased Engagement: It fosters two-way communication with your audience. You can create engaging content, interact with customers on social media platforms, and build stronger brand loyalty.

 

Key Strategies for Digital Marketing Success

 

Social Media Marketing: As per data reportal, There were 10.00 million social media users in Nepal in January 2020.

This clearly shows digital literacy in Nepali and nowadays platforms like Facebook, Instagram, Tiktok has become one of the popular advertising platforms for everyone.

Content Marketing: 84% of consumers expect companies to produce entertaining and helpful content experiences. So, focusing on content marketing is necessary.  Whether it’s blog posts, videos, or infographics, compelling content can attract organic traffic and nurture leads over time.

Email Marketing: Despite the rise of social media, email marketing remains a potent tool for driving customer engagement and nurturing relationships. Small businesses can build an email list of subscribers and send out personalised offers, updates, and newsletters to keep their audience informed and engaged.

Expanding on the Value

 

In addition to the benefits outlined above, online marketing in Nepal offers unique opportunities for businesses to differentiate themselves and stand out in a competitive market. Here’s how:

Localization Strategies: In a country where regional dialects and languages vary significantly, localization is key to effective marketing. Digital marketing services can help businesses adapt their content, messaging, and communication channels to suit different regions and language preferences. Whether it’s translating website content into local languages or running targeted ad campaigns, localization strategies can enhance relevance and engagement among diverse audiences.

Mobile-First Approach: With the proliferation of smartphones and mobile internet usage, adopting a mobile-first approach is essential for success in Nepal’s digital landscape. Digital marketing services can optimize websites and content for mobile devices, ensuring seamless user experiences and accessibility across different screen sizes. Whether it’s responsive web design, mobile-friendly ads, or SMS marketing campaigns, prioritizing mobile optimization can significantly enhance reach and engagement among mobile-savvy Nepalese consumers.

Economic Empowerment: By lowering barriers to entry and providing affordable marketing solutions, digital platforms enable small businesses and startups to compete on a level playing field with larger enterprises. This democratization of marketing resources fosters innovation, creativity, and economic growth across various sectors of the Nepalese economy.
